Output 84d793efb8cba5eb0641d9c2a78e298414f02d1a58746d4fe76f7dcf39313963:0

value
150386625
script pubkey
OP_0 OP_PUSHBYTES_20 a3670ac12fe7f247f4eadc3de93bd4b345a5a3d4
address
ltc1q5dns4sf0uley0a82ms77jw75kdz6tg75fqzyvj
transaction
84d793efb8cba5eb0641d9c2a78e298414f02d1a58746d4fe76f7dcf39313963
spent
true